May 6, 2015… The steamy story of a midlife affair that shook the foundations of the ancient world comes to vivid life in the Stratford Festival production of Shakespeare’s Antony and Cleopatra, starring Geraint Wyn Davies and Yanna McIntosh as the powerful rulers whose insatiable love leads to the greatest of tragedies. Director Gary Griffin paints an unforgettable landscape depicting the devastation wrought by the heart’s transgressions.
Filmed in spectacular HD under the direction of Barry Avrich, Antony and Cleopatra premières in cinemas throughout Canada and the U.S. on May 21. The Canadian encore screening is on June 7. U.S. encore dates vary. For more information visit www.stratfordfestival.ca/HD.

Antony and Cleopatra is produced by Melbar Entertainment Group in association with the Stratford Festival, Artistic Director Antoni Cimolino, and Executive Producers Barry Avrich, Anita Gaffney and Michael A. Levine.
This production is part of a massive initiative by the Stratford Festival, North America’s leading classical theatre company, to capture all of Shakespeare’s plays over the next 10 years. The series, which began with the Stratford Festival’s critically acclaimed production of King Lear in February, followed by King John in April and now Antony and Cleopatra, will ultimately create the first North American collection of the complete works of William Shakespeare.
Stratford Festival HD is sponsored by Sun Life Financial as part of their Making the Arts More Accessible® program, with generous support from Laura Dinner & Richard Rooney, the Jenkins Family Foundation, Ophelia & Mike Lazaridis, Sandra & Jim Pitblado and Robert & Jacqueline Sperandio.
Canadian distribution is through Cineplex Entertainment’s Front Row Centre Events, which specializes in bringing world-class events and performances to the big screen. Cinema screenings will be followed by a broadcast window on CBC-TV, Canada’s national public broadcaster. Digital and on-demand release will follow.
U.S. distribution is through BY Experience, the “live cinema event powerhouse” (Variety) that brings the highest quality international cultural events to more than 2,000 cinemas and performing arts centres in over 60 countries around the world as the Worldwide HD Distribution Representative for The Met: Live in HD series, International (ex-UK) Distribution Representative for the U.K.’s National Theatre Live series, and North American Distributor for the Bolshoi Ballet cinema series.
